For most firms, 1 July is not the problem. The problem is that AML compliance is landing on top of a lodgement process that is already slow.

A single document still takes around 25 minutes to prepare. Open the PDF, find the right Word template, copy across the entity details and amounts, stitch it together, upload it to a signing tool, then chase the client for weeks. Now add a separate KYC tool on top of that. More steps, more tools, more time.

In our recent webinar, Admiin founder Darren Hosiosky walked through a different approach: one drag-and-drop workflow that takes a lodgement from intake to signed, paid, and verified, with KYC built in as a single click. The same work that took 25 minutes drops to about 4. One firm, Logica, cut their prep time by 84% and was compliant before the deadline.

Getting your documents into Admiin

Do I have to upload everything manually? No. You can drag and drop a document, push it across from XPM, or forward it into Admiin from your own unique platform email address. You can forward up to 100 documents at once, and the system ingests them ready to process.

Will it pull client information from Xero or XPM? Yes. The XPM integration is two-way. Update a client's email in Admiin and it updates in XPM, and the other way around.

Which integrations are live right now? XPM and Xero are active today. More are on the roadmap, including FYI, with several partners rolling out over the next two to three months.

Does it sync with Asana, or connect through Zapier or similar? Not at this stage. The active integrations are XPM and Xero, with more coming over the next few months, so there is no Asana or Zapier connection today. If the goal is getting documents in, the flexible path is email forwarding. Every user gets a unique Admiin inbox, so you can forward documents straight into the platform. The team can share what is planned next if a particular tool matters to you.

The lodgement workflow and signing

Is there a review and approval step? Yes. Flag a document for review and it goes to the manager who looks after that client. They can edit it, approve it, or reject it back to the team member who created it.

Is there a downloadable audit trail? Yes. You get a full record of who viewed and signed each document, plus a digital certificate of completion. You can download these one by one or in bulk, which is useful for keeping KYC records.

Can I redact the PRN for individual income tax clients? Yes, there is an option to redact it. Keep in mind the PRN is how the client pays, so if you redact it they can still reach it securely through an encrypted link.

Can I use Admiin for engagement letters and onboarding? Yes. Send your engagement letter for e-signature from a template, attach a payment if there is a retainer, and run KYC in the same flow. If it needs a signature, you can do it in Admiin.

Payments and fees

Does the platform cost the firm anything? No. The core platform is free. Admiin earns when a client chooses to pay their liability by card. Clients can always pay by bank transfer at no cost, so nobody is forced down a payment path.

What is the client card processing fee? A fixed fee of 1.7% for all card types, including Amex. Because it is fixed regardless of card type, it sits outside the variable card surcharge rules.

Do the new surcharge rules apply to this? No. Those rules target variable surcharges that change with the card type. Admiin charges one fixed processing fee, so it does not fall under them. This was confirmed with legal advice.

Can the firm get paid for its own fees through Admiin? Yes. Once your firm is verified, you can receive client payments into a digital wallet and connect your own invoicing. You can on-charge clients or absorb the fees. It is completely optional.

Do we need to declare this in our engagement letters, since the firm benefits from a platform the client pays through? It helps to be clear on the model first. The platform is free to your firm, and the card processing fee on a client payment goes to Admiin, not to you. So your firm does not earn anything from a client paying their ATO liability through Admiin. The only time money flows to your firm is if you choose to use the invoicing feature to collect your own fees, which is optional. Whether anything needs to be disclosed in your engagement terms is a matter for your own professional and TPB obligations, so check with your professional body if you are unsure. Admiin is not a substitute for that advice.

What if the client does not take the payment option? Nothing changes. They can still review and sign as normal. The payment step is optional, and clients can pay by bank transfer at no cost if they prefer. Declining to pay by card does not stop them using the workflow.

KYC and AML

Who actually runs the checks, Admiin or a third party? Admiin aggregates. In the background it connects to around 12 databases, including DVS and ID match, face verification, VEVO, the ABR, ASIC, and international PEP and sanctions lists. You get one simple touch and we run every check behind it.

How is KYC priced? There is no subscription. It is usage based, charged per check, and you can see each cost line by line. An individual starts at about $3.47. Company and UBO checks run higher depending on how deep the structure goes. You can export CSVs per client or per period to reconcile, and most firms on-charge this to their clients.

If a client has 10 entities, do I pay for 10 checks? No. Admiin checks for duplicate UBOs across entities. Once a person is verified, that verification carries across, so you only pay for the checks that are actually needed.

Can I trigger KYC straight from the document screen? Yes. If a client has not started verification, you can fire it off from their screen with one click.

Can anyone on the team run a verification? Yes, everyone can out of the box. If you want to limit it to certain team members, you can set that in your settings.

How do I get my existing client base compliant before 1 July? Bulk verify up to 1,000 clients at once. Send a branded warm-up email first, then Admiin handles the SMS and email onboarding for each client. This is how firms with a large book get compliant without it taking months.

Is the audit trail for KYC checks downloadable, and are client IDs stored after the check? Yes, the audit trail and check results are downloadable, one by one or in bulk, and they make up your compliance record. Identity records are stored securely in line with AML obligations and kept for seven years, so the trail is retained by design rather than deleted after a check.

One thing to watch when comparing providers. Compare like for like. Some tools only run a basic check, which raises the failure rate and can mean paying for a verification twice. And note that Australia Post TPB checks are not AUSTRAC compliant on their own.
